Competitive gaming, commonly known as esports, has become a global phenomenon within the broader world of online games. Professional players train rigorously, mastering complex mechanics and strategies to perform at the highest level. International tournaments attract massive audiences, both online and in arenas, transforming games into spectator events comparable to traditional sports. Sponsorships, prize pools, and dedicated broadcasting platforms have turned esports into a thriving industry, inspiring new generations to view gaming as a legitimate career path.
